BBG Ventures: About
The company operates as a direct‑to‑consumer e‑commerce brand portfolio. It creates or sources consumer products (currently visible in the pet category) and sells them under distinct brand sites hosted on a standard e‑commerce platform. Value is created by curating specific product lines and marketing them efficiently online, rather than by providing technology or services to other businesses.
Customer acquisition is driven largely by paid social media advertising, routing traffic to brand storefronts where purchases are completed via standard checkout flows. Revenue is captured through retail margins between product cost and online sale price. The business model is asset‑light on technology, relying on third‑party e‑commerce infrastructure while focusing internal effort on product selection, branding, and performance marketing.
BBG Ventures: Market Position
BBG Ventures LLC is a United States–based e‑commerce operator running a portfolio of direct‑to‑consumer online brands. Its current visible activity centres on a pet supplies shop that sells physical cat toys and accessories via a hosted storefront (Shopify) and standard online checkout. The company was founded by students at the University of Wisconsin–Madison and is incorporated in Wisconsin.
The firm generates revenue from one‑off product sales of consumer goods, acquired primarily through paid social media advertising. End customers are individual consumers, particularly pet owners purchasing online in the United States. There is no evidence of SaaS, marketplace, or enterprise offerings; the business functions as a small brand portfolio retailer using social channels for customer acquisition.
